winetricks
winetricks copied to clipboard
64-bit dinput8.dll Installation
Using a 64-bit Wine prefix, it seems as if a new dinput8.dll is installed only in syswow64. It would be nice if a 64-bit version of dinput8 were also provided alongside it in system32 (as opposed to, say, downloading said DLL from another website).
A cursory glance at the DirectX seems to indicate the lack of a 64-bit version of said DLL, strange enough. Hopefully this isn't too difficult of an issue to resolve!
Doesn't appear to be one in the current service packs we have (there's only a 32-bit one in winxpsp3).
A quick search for dinput8 on {download,support}.microsoft.com shows nothing useful, so until someone finds one, I can't do anything for this.
I guess the dinput8.dll is also included in https://www.microsoft.com/accessories/de-de/d/xbox-360-controller-for-windows but had no chance to install it.
I think the below should do the trick. @`Chromace": could you try the below code (copy/paste in winetricks) and do 'winetricks install_dinput8' and see if it works for your game? Regards d8.txt
Thank you! However, the game that previously required this DLL no longer does - it's switched from DirectInput to Raw Input. My apologies for being unable to test this out!
how can I execute the code or how or where can I paste the code in winetricks?
I've cleaned up the proposed patch. It would be helpful if someone could test the above commit with an affected application.
You can use https://raw.githubusercontent.com/austin987/winetricks/4a1627d51914464dd967d08d8f90452b1c9ee270/src/winetricks to try a version of winetricks with the incorporated changes.
Hi,
I encountered the same issue, with Trackmania which require x64 dinput8.dll.
I've tried your patch, but when downloading Windows6.0-KB936330-X64-wave0.exe
directly from microsoft.com, it failed, then tried to download via web.archive.org, but failed at 97%.
Using a manually downloaded Windows6.0-KB936330-X64-wave0.exe, the dinput8.dll x64 file installs and make Trackmania work fine, so the issue is only with the download.
doc@DOC-PC3:~$ ./winetricks --force dinput8
------------------------------------------------------
warning: You are using a 64-bit WINEPREFIX. Note that many verbs only install 32-bit versions of packages. If you encounter problems, please retest in a clean 32-bit WINEPREFIX before reporting a bug.
------------------------------------------------------
Using winetricks 20230212-next - sha256sum: f96e7514353bb9ba7de2c92f0c240b3269cf44e0f02a74b2ab6a30caaa0f1181 with wine-8.8 (Staging) and WINEARCH=win64
Executing w_do_call dinput8
------------------------------------------------------
warning: You are using a 64-bit WINEPREFIX. Note that many verbs only install 32-bit versions of packages. If you encounter problems, please retest in a clean 32-bit WINEPREFIX before reporting a bug.
------------------------------------------------------
Executing load_dinput8
Executing mkdir -p /home/doc/.cache/winetricks/winvista
Executing cd /home/doc/.cache/winetricks/winvista
Downloading https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e to /home/doc/.cache/winetricks/winvista
05/21 19:36:47 [NOTICE] Downloading 1 item(s)
05/21 19:36:47 [ERROR] CUID#7 - Download aborted. URI=https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
Exception: [AbstractCommand.cc:351] errorCode=3 URI=https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
-> [HttpSkipResponseCommand.cc:218] errorCode=3 Ressource introuvable
05/21 19:36:47 [NOTICE] Téléchargement GID#464e5a69b4485106 non terminé : /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
Résultats du téléchargement:
gid |stat|avg speed |path/URI
======+====+===========+=======================================================
464e5a|ERR | 0B/s|/home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
Légende du statut:
(ERR): Une erreur est survenue.
aria2c va recommencer ce téléchargement si le transfert est relancé.
En cas d'erreurs, merci de lire le fichier log. Voir l'option '-l' pour plus d'informations.
Executing cd /home/doc/.cache/winetricks/winvista
Downloading https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e to /home/doc/.cache/winetricks/winvista
05/21 19:36:48 [NOTICE] Downloading 1 item(s)
05/21 19:36:49 [NOTICE] CUID#7 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 16KiB/726MiB(0%) CN:5 DL:195KiB ETA:1h3m30s]
05/21 19:36:55 [NOTICE] CUID#11 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
05/21 19:36:55 [NOTICE] CUID#9 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
05/21 19:36:55 [NOTICE] CUID#12 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
05/21 19:36:55 [NOTICE] CUID#10 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 3.4MiB/726MiB(0%) CN:5 DL:1.5MiB ETA:7m58s]
05/21 19:36:57 [NOTICE] CUID#11 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 28MiB/726MiB(3%) CN:5 DL:2.6MiB ETA:4m18s]
05/21 19:37:08 [NOTICE] CUID#9 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 72MiB/726MiB(9%) CN:5 DL:3.9MiB ETA:2m44s]
05/21 19:37:18 [NOTICE] CUID#9 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
*** Download Progress Summary as of Sun May 21 19:37:48 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 137MiB/726MiB(18%) CN:5 DL:2.3MiB ETA:4m10s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
*** Download Progress Summary as of Sun May 21 19:38:48 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 231MiB/726MiB(31%) CN:5 DL:1.3MiB ETA:6m12s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
[#13a68d 285MiB/726MiB(39%) CN:5 DL:1.2MiB ETA:5m47s]
05/21 19:39:26 [NOTICE] CUID#11 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 313MiB/726MiB(43%) CN:5 DL:2.7MiB ETA:2m32s]
05/21 19:39:37 [NOTICE] CUID#11 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
*** Download Progress Summary as of Sun May 21 19:39:49 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 327MiB/726MiB(45%) CN:5 DL:1.1MiB ETA:5m59s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
*** Download Progress Summary as of Sun May 21 19:40:50 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 428MiB/726MiB(59%) CN:5 DL:1.5MiB ETA:3m9s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
[#13a68d 436MiB/726MiB(60%) CN:5 DL:2.0MiB ETA:2m24s]
05/21 19:40:53 [NOTICE] CUID#10 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
*** Download Progress Summary as of Sun May 21 19:41:50 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 523MiB/726MiB(71%) CN:5 DL:2.2MiB ETA:1m29s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
[#13a68d 526MiB/726MiB(72%) CN:5 DL:2.1MiB ETA:1m34s]
05/21 19:41:53 [NOTICE] CUID#12 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 529MiB/726MiB(72%) CN:5 DL:1.9MiB ETA:1m41s]
05/21 19:41:55 [ERROR] CUID#11 - Download aborted. URI=https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
Exception: [DownloadCommand.cc:234] errorCode=1 Obtenir la fin du fichier (EOF) du serveur.
*** Download Progress Summary as of Sun May 21 19:42:51 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 620MiB/726MiB(85%) CN:4 DL:1.1MiB ETA:1m32s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
[#13a68d 693MiB/726MiB(95%) CN:3 DL:543KiB ETA:1m1s]
05/21 19:43:50 [ERROR] CUID#12 - Download aborted. URI=https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
Exception: [DownloadCommand.cc:234] errorCode=1 Obtenir la fin du fichier (EOF) du serveur.
[#13a68d 693MiB/726MiB(95%) CN:3 DL:451KiB ETA:1m14s]
05/21 19:43:50 [NOTICE] CUID#15 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
*** Download Progress Summary as of Sun May 21 19:43:51 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 693MiB/726MiB(95%) CN:3 DL:366KiB ETA:1m31s]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
[#13a68d 706MiB/726MiB(97%) CN:2 DL:1.7MiB ETA:11s]
05/21 19:43:59 [ERROR] CUID#15 - Download aborted. URI=https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
Exception: [DownloadCommand.cc:234] errorCode=1 Obtenir la fin du fichier (EOF) du serveur.
[#13a68d 706MiB/726MiB(97%) CN:1 DL:0B]
05/21 19:44:17 [NOTICE] CUID#16 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 706MiB/726MiB(97%) CN:1 DL:0B]
05/21 19:44:41 [ERROR] CUID#16 - Download aborted. URI=https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
Exception: [DownloadCommand.cc:234] errorCode=1 Obtenir la fin du fichier (EOF) du serveur.
[#13a68d 706MiB/726MiB(97%) CN:1 DL:0B]
05/21 19:44:42 [NOTICE] CUID#17 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
[#13a68d 706MiB/726MiB(97%) CN:1 DL:0B]
05/21 19:44:52 [NOTICE] CUID#17 - Redirecting to https://web.archive.org/web/20100925181145/http://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
*** Download Progress Summary as of Sun May 21 19:44:53 2023 ***
===========================================================================================================================================================================================================================================
[#13a68d 706MiB/726MiB(97%) CN:1 DL:0B]
FILE: /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
[#13a68d 706MiB/726MiB(97%) CN:1 DL:0B]
05/21 19:45:01 [ERROR] CUID#17 - Download aborted. URI=https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e
Exception: [DownloadCommand.cc:234] errorCode=1 Obtenir la fin du fichier (EOF) du serveur.
05/21 19:45:01 [NOTICE] Téléchargement GID#13a68de857bbbed7 non terminé : /home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
Résultats du téléchargement:
gid |stat|avg speed |path/URI
======+====+===========+=======================================================
13a68d|ERR | 1.4MiB/s|/home/doc/.cache/winetricks/winvista/Windows6.0-KB936330-X64-wave0.exe
Légende du statut:
(ERR): Une erreur est survenue.
aria2c va recommencer ce téléchargement si le transfert est relancé.
En cas d'erreurs, merci de lire le fichier log. Voir l'option '-l' pour plus d'informations.
------------------------------------------------------
warning: Downloading https://web.archive.org/web/2000/https://download.microsoft.com/download/8/3/b/83b8c814-b000-44a4-b667-8c1f58727b8b/Windows6.0-KB936330-X64-wave0.exe failed
------------------------------------------------------